wasp/examples/waspello
Anthony Suárez 0cde880f24
Feat: Validate wasp version from spec (#786)
* Add wasp field to AppSpec.App

* Validate app.wasp.version in AppSpec.Valid

* Add app.wasp.version field on .wasp file generated by CreateNewProject

* Add app.wasp.version to .wasp files of e2e tests

* Add app.wasp.version to examples' .wasp files

* Add app.wasp.version to docs

* Change waspc version from 0.6.0.0 to 0.6.0

* Change app.wasp.version validation to use regular semver

* Format code

* Refactor app.wasp.version validation

* Refactor app.wasp.version validation

* Update supported app.wasp.version format in docs

* Add TODO to validateWaspVersion

* Refactor app.wasp.version using toEnum

* Create Wasp.Version module with waspVersion constant

* Fix parseWaspVersionRange regex

Fixed:
  - The regex wasn't checking the string *starts* with ^.
  - The . symbols were not escaped.
  - The $ token is not specified as supported in the regex-tdfa docs.
    \' is used instead.

* Add comment explaining wasp version validation restrictions

* Use Wasp.Version.waspVersion instead of Paths_wasp.version
2022-10-31 23:00:03 +01:00
..
ext Waspello: Implemented add card and copy list actions in list popover 2022-10-28 13:09:19 +02:00
migrations Renames auth method EmailAndPassword to UsernameAndPassword (#696) 2022-08-24 10:32:46 -04:00
.gitignore renamed trello example to waspello. 2021-10-11 14:03:03 +02:00
.wasproot renamed trello example to waspello. 2021-10-11 14:03:03 +02:00
main.wasp Feat: Validate wasp version from spec (#786) 2022-10-31 23:00:03 +01:00
README.md Add README for [example/Waspello] (fix #663) (#738) 2022-10-12 14:39:23 +03:00

Waspello

Waspello is a trello clone app made with Wasp.

This app is deployed at https://waspello.netlify.app/.

The backend is hosted on Heroku - @matijaSos

Development

Database

Wasp needs the Postgres database running. Check out the docs for details on how to setup PostgreSQL

Running

wasp start